Why Choose Aluminium? The Core Benefits
Aluminium is a non-ferrous metal prized for its extraordinary strength-to-weight ratio. When crafted into doors and window frames, this product brings a host of unique benefits to property and business properties.
1. Slim Sightlines and Maximum Glass
Because aluminium is incredibly strong, frames can be made much thinner than their timber or uPVC equivalents. Thicker frames obstruct views and limit natural light. Aluminium enables for expansive glass panes, developing a seamless connection in between indoor and outside home.
2. Extraordinary Durability
Unlike wood, aluminium does not warp, swell, fracture, or split in time due to moisture or temperature variations. Unlike basic plastics, it does not end up being fragile under extreme UV radiation. It stands resilient against harsh weather conditions, making it a long-lasting investment for any residential or commercial property.
3. Low Maintenance
House owners often lead hectic lives and prefer products that require very little maintenance. Aluminium frames need no sanding, staining, or painting. A periodic clean down with soapy water is all it requires to keep them looking brand name new for decades.
4. Eco-Friendly and Sustainable
Sustainability is a major concern in modern construction. Aluminium is 100% recyclable and can be recycled definitely without losing its structural properties. In addition, the recycling process requires only about 5% of the energy utilized to produce primary aluminium, making it an ecologically accountable choice.

Resolving Thermal Efficiency: The Myth of the Cold Metal
A typical issue regarding aluminium doors and windows is thermal performance. Historically, due to the fact that metal is a conductor of heat, older aluminium frames utilized to move heat and cold rather easily, leading to condensation and bad energy ratings.
Nevertheless, contemporary engineering has completely solved this issue through thermal break innovation.
A thermal break is a constant barrier-- generally made of strengthened polyamide insulating plastic-- positioned between the interior and outside aluminium profiles. This barrier interrupts the thermal course, stopping heat from escaping your home in the winter and entering your home in the summer. When integrated with double or triple-glazed glass, aluminium windows and doors easily meet and exceed rigid contemporary energy-efficiency standards.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are aluminium windows and doors pricey?
Upfront, aluminium frames typically cost more than basic uPVC, though they are typically more budget friendly than high-end hardwoods. However, because of their extraordinary longevity, zero upkeep expenses, and energy-saving homes, aluminium products use an exceptional roi over their lifespan.
2. Do aluminium frames rust?
No, aluminium does not rust due to the fact that it includes no iron. While steel can rust when exposed to moisture, aluminium forms a protective oxide layer that guards it from deterioration. For coastal areas, marine-grade powder coating can be applied to secure against salty air.
3. Can aluminium windows be painted a various color later?
While it is technically possible to paint powder-coated aluminium utilizing specialised primers and paints, it is not suggested to do it yourself. It is best to select the exact color you want at the time of purchase, as factory-applied powder coatings are baked on for ultimate resilience.
